Strategizing for Optimal Outdoor Living Space Design
Designing an outdoor space requires careful planning to ensure functionality meets aesthetics. Homeowners should take multiple factors into account, including size, usability, and personal preferences. Understanding how to maximize space while introducing vital elements will lead to a successful outdoor living area.
Key Elements to Consider in Design Layouts
Begin by considering the purpose of your outdoor space. Is it for entertaining, relaxation, or a combination of both? Identifying this will influence your design layout. Additionally, elements such as:
- Traffic flow through the space
- Proximity to the house
- Integration of lighting and other amenities
should also be assessed carefully to enhance usability.

Local Regulations: What You Need to Know
As outdoor living projects can alter the landscape of a property, awareness of local regulations is critical. Gathering the right information beforehand can save time and frustration during the installation process.
Building Permits and Inspection Processes
Most outdoor living projects, especially larger constructions, require building permits. Navigating local regulations, such as those from Ashland, can be cumbersome but is necessary for compliance. Contractors typically handle these permits, ensuring that work aligns with local building codes.
HOA Guidelines for Outdoor Living Spaces
Many neighborhoods are governed by Homeowners Associations (HOAs) that enforce specific guidelines regarding exterior modifications. Before beginning a project, homeowners should review their HOAās rules, as they may impact choices like materials, colors, and design elements.

How to Choose the Right Contractor
When selecting a contractor, look for credentials like licensing, insurance, and experience. Checking reviews and past project examples can provide insights into their reliability and craftsmanship. Itās wise to evaluate potential contractors based on:
- Experience and specialties in outdoor living design.
- Warranties offered on their work.
- Customer support and responsiveness throughout the project.
Questions to Ask Before Hiring
Before making a final decision, clients should pose specific questions to potential contractors. Inquiries might include:
- What is the estimated timeline for completion?
- Can you provide references or testimonials from past clients?
- How will you handle unexpected circumstances during the project?
